Handover — Annual Billing Transition

To the incoming director: Pellarch Software shifts all subscriptions to annual billing effective next fiscal year. Monthly plans close to new signups in March. Migration discounts approved for legacy accounts; churn modeling done by the Ralbeck team, worst case 6%. Finance tooling update is mid-build — chase the Ardenfold group weekly or it slips. Renewal comms drafted, not sent. Legal cleared terms. Everything else is in the shared tracker. One last item follows below, and it stays between us.

board note of kagaf-tahog: Ulaoxek Systems is in early talks to buy Ralokek Group for about $329.6 million. The Wenys launch date is September 16, and nothing goes to the press before then. Legal wants the Keloxox Foods term sheet signed before June 7.

Handover — Fenwright Licensing Dispute

For the incoming director: Calder Systems claims our Quillon module breaches their 2019 license terms. Outside counsel disagrees; their opinion is on file. Mediation set for next quarter. Do not contact Calder directly — everything goes through legal. Settlement authority capped pending board review. Renewal talks on unrelated Calder contracts are paused. Where this fits in our plans is set out in the confidential note below.

board note of bagug-kafof: The steering committee signed off on a budget of $55.0 million for Project Fraox. The renewal with Fenvanek Freight closes at $37.0 million a year, 4 percent above the last contract.

Ticket: Config drift on Scrubhawk EXIF service

The Scrubhawk image-scrubbing workers in the Delvane region are running different strip rules than the other regions — GPS tags are removed but camera serials are passing through. Likely cause: a hotfix applied manually last quarter and never committed. Please reconcile all regions against the canonical values, which are:

config for hahaf-kafof:
[wenys]
host = wenys.torvahq.corp
user = wenys_svc
database = wenys_prod

Because it reads process internals, it runs under a tightly scoped service identity, and every report upload to the internal evidence vault is authenticated and signed. Reviewers should confirm the identity has no write access beyond the vault's intake bucket, and that sampling respects the namespace allowlist. Vault intake for the review environment authenticates with the key shown below.

API key for yahig-tadup: kto7_ubizbYm